# HG changeset patch # User displacer # Date 1199720653 0 # Node ID 32a546d1eb3e69dceaf642214c7561e84126f5f2 # Parent 07787e748831c061eb597f26c932f735a6f3c4fa prepare weapons combo diff -r 07787e748831 -r 32a546d1eb3e QTfrontend/pages.cpp --- a/QTfrontend/pages.cpp Mon Jan 07 13:09:10 2008 +0000 +++ b/QTfrontend/pages.cpp Mon Jan 07 15:44:13 2008 +0000 @@ -308,7 +308,7 @@ AGGroupBox = new QGroupBox(this); AGGroupBox->setSizePolicy(QSizePolicy::Expanding, QSizePolicy::Fixed); AGGroupBox->setTitle(QGroupBox::tr("Audio/Graphic options")); - pageLayout->addWidget(AGGroupBox, 1, 1); + pageLayout->addWidget(AGGroupBox, 2, 1); QVBoxLayout * GBAlayout = new QVBoxLayout(AGGroupBox); QHBoxLayout * GBAreslayout = new QHBoxLayout(0); @@ -351,12 +351,21 @@ BtnBack = addButton("Back", pageLayout, 4, 0); - WeaponsButt = addButton("Weapons scheme", pageLayout, 1, 0); + QGroupBox* groupWeapons = new QGroupBox(this); + groupWeapons->setSizePolicy(QSizePolicy::Expanding, QSizePolicy::Fixed); + groupWeapons->setTitle(QGroupBox::tr("Weapons")); + pageLayout->addWidget(groupWeapons, 1, 0, 1, 3); + QGridLayout * WeaponsLayout = new QGridLayout(groupWeapons); + + WeaponsButt = addButton("Weapons scheme", WeaponsLayout, 0, 0); + WeaponsName = new QComboBox(this); + WeaponsLayout->addWidget(WeaponsName, 0, 1); + WeaponEdit = addButton("Edit", WeaponsLayout, 0, 2); NNGroupBox = new QGroupBox(this); NNGroupBox->setSizePolicy(QSizePolicy::MinimumExpanding, QSizePolicy::Fixed); NNGroupBox->setTitle(QGroupBox::tr("Net options")); - pageLayout->addWidget(NNGroupBox, 1, 2); + pageLayout->addWidget(NNGroupBox, 2, 2); QGridLayout * GBNlayout = new QGridLayout(NNGroupBox); labelNN = new QLabel(NNGroupBox); diff -r 07787e748831 -r 32a546d1eb3e QTfrontend/pages.h --- a/QTfrontend/pages.h Mon Jan 07 13:09:10 2008 +0000 +++ b/QTfrontend/pages.h Mon Jan 07 15:44:13 2008 +0000 @@ -174,6 +174,9 @@ PageOptions(QWidget* parent = 0); QPushButton* WeaponsButt; + QPushButton* WeaponEdit; + QComboBox* WeaponsName; + QPushButton *BtnBack; QGroupBox *groupBox; QPushButton *BtnNewTeam; diff -r 07787e748831 -r 32a546d1eb3e hedgewars.kdevelop --- a/hedgewars.kdevelop Mon Jan 07 13:09:10 2008 +0000 +++ b/hedgewars.kdevelop Mon Jan 07 15:44:13 2008 +0000 @@ -18,20 +18,20 @@ hedgewars . false - + kdevsubversion - + executable / bin/hedgewars - + false true - + false false @@ -172,16 +172,16 @@ make - + true 1 0 false - - - + + + default @@ -189,9 +189,9 @@ 0 - - - + + + default @@ -200,12 +200,12 @@ - + - - - - + + + + true false false @@ -311,7 +311,7 @@ false - + set m_,_ theValue